160 +/- acres of dryland farm ground with great access, access from Highway 27 or Highway 50.
Land
Gently sloping and in prime wheat country this quarter has wheat growing on it. Consists primarily of Colby silt loam, 1-3 percent slopes.

Region & Climate
Syracuse has a generally mild climate with a average high temperature of 69.7F and an average low of 40F. The area averages 16.8 inches of rainfall annually, primarily coming in the summer during the growing season.
